Quote:
Also, how do people pick the names for their characters, places etc? Usually I use name generators or name-meaning websites, but sometimes I get dumb names out of them. What does everyone else think?
Hmm... names always seem to come to me. But I agree with what Meela said about using normal names and just twisting them around a bit. For example, I took one of my friends' last name, Jetton, took some letters out, added some letters, and got the name Jeteiryn. You could also take a regular name and change the spelling to where it still sounds the same but looks different, like what I did with Ryan, changing it to Ryon.
